Come discover the African continent. On Dec 23, 2009, He said, “we need to tell our children the truth”. He invites all to come home in 2012 to celebrate “our cultural heritage. “ we need a museum which basically aims at satisfying the quest of many of our people, children, friends, lovers of our clan and why not archaeologists who are all invited to visit our Clan and our palace? Look, some may want to study, some for leisure, support our children , their families and communities in the socio-cultural and intellectual spheres, as well as support government's effort to sustain and promote exchange visits to Cameroon” . The traditional ruler called on the Meta Children, friends, visitors, partners at home and abroad to work in Unity, love one another, encouraged the population present to work hand-in-glove to overcome eminent challenges facing community development of the Meta Clan. The main difficulties, according to FonTabi, includes the lack of good roads, health facilities, safe clean drinking water, expertise to collect, conserve and preserve artworks, and inadequate finances to get qualified staff for effective educational services in building of the Community Technical College and others..
